Poppers maculopathy is a condition characterized by bilateral sub-foveal ellipsoid zone disruption, yellow foveal spot, and reduced visual acuity. Maculopathy occurs after use of "poppers, "volatile liquid substances containing alkyl nitrites that are recreationally inhaled. Patients experience symptoms of blurred vision, central scotoma, metamorphopsia, or other central visual disturbances in the days to weeks after using poppers.... Poppers maculopathy is a rare, often subclinical manifestation of recreational drug use that is best diagnosed with OCT [optical coherence tomography] and a careful case history. 1, record 1, English, - poppers%20maculopathy

La maculopathie au nitrite d'alkyle [...] est une affection rare mais qui peut survenir de manière aiguë quelle que soit la chronicité de la prise de cette substance. Les nitrites d'alkyle étaient autrefois utilisés dans la prise en charge de l'angor du fait de leurs propriétés vasodilatatrices. Abandonnés ensuite au profit de la trinitrine, ils font maintenant l'objet d'un mésusage pour ses propriétés récréatives [...] L'examen du fond d'œil peut montrer de petites taches jaunâtres maculaires, mais peut être normal. L'OCT [tomographie par cohérence optique] montre une atteinte des photorécepteurs maculaires. 1, record 1, French, - maculopathie%20au%20nitrite%20d%27alkyle

An intermediary area located between the hot and cold zones where additional response actions could take place. 3, record 2, English, - warm%20zone
Record number: 2, Textual support number: 1 OBS
This zone is where decontamination of personnel and equipment takes place. It includes control points for the access corridor and thus assists in reducing the spread of contamination. 4, record 2, English, - warm%20zone

A green, yellow, brown, gray, or white hexagonal mineral of the apatite group [which] is found in the oxidized zone of lead deposits, and is a minor ore of lead. 3, record 4, English, - pyromorphite
Record number: 4,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Chemical formula: Pb5(PO4)3Cl 4, record 4, English, - pyromorphite

Les résultats des candidats au TAPAC [test d'aptitudes physiques de l'agent de correction] seraient classés selon trois zones plutôt qu'en fonction d'un système de réussite ou d'échec total. Zone verte : le candidat exécute le test en 2 h 40 ou moins et satisfait à la norme. Zone jaune : la durée d'exécution du test se situe entre 2 h 41 et 3 h 30; le candidat ne satisfait pas à la norme et bénéficie d'une période de six mois à un an avant de repasser le test; entre-temps, il garde son poste d'AC [agent de correction]. Zone rouge : (temps d'exécution de 3 h 31 et plus) : le titulaire doit sérieusement travailler à améliorer sa condition physique; son cas peut être renvoyé au Comité régional d'accommodement, en particulier s'il s'agit d'un cas d'invalidité. 1, record 6, French, - approche%20consistant%20%C3%A0%20%C3%A9tablir%20des%20normes%20d%27%C3%A9valuation%20selon%20la%20dur%C3%A9e%20d%27ex%C3%A9cution%20du%20TAPAC

Between 600 metres and 900 metres above sea level is the subalpine mountain hemlock zone dominated by mountain hemlock and yellow cedar. As the elevation increases, the green cloak of evergreen forest begins to break up into krummholz-stunted clumps of trees. 1, record 7, English, - subalpine%20mountain%20hemlock%20zone
